IP Check: 194.169.95.152

Country: United Kingdom  

We found 2 matches for IP Addresses '194.169.95.152'

Most Recent Activity:

April 24, 2024: winona@1000welectricscooter.net
April 21, 2024: helene@building.ink

DateNameEmailIPFrom
2024-04-24 07:55 PM winona winona@1000welectricscooter.net 194.169.95.152
2024-04-21 03:15 PM helene helene@building.ink 194.169.95.152